Laboratory measurements include:
1. Measurement of power quality.
2. Measurement of grid-connected PV inverter.
3. Investigations on digital overcurrent protection in the case of distributed generation.
4. Electricity market simulator.
5. PLC.
6. Investigations on digital motor protection.
7. NInvestigations on frequency regulation with DIgSILENT Power Factory.
8. Investigations on electromagnetic transients of synchronous machines.
9. EMC measurements in a substation.
10. Investigations on power transmission with computer simulation.számítógépen.
During the semester:
· Students should study the supplementary material of the measurements.
· Students measure in groups or individually, according to a schedule. Only those students can participate in a measurement, who passed the short tests written at the beginning of the measurements.
· A report has to be made and submitted, containing the findings of the measurement until the given deadline.
· Students get part ratings based on their short tests, their contribution on the measurement and their report. The final grade is calculated as an average off all the part ratings.

Late submission of the measurement record can be approved by the end of the supplementary week, if supplementary fee has been paid. (TVSZ 16.§ (2))
The missed measurements (due to missing or failing of entry test) can be substituted during the semester or the supplementary week according to the following rules:
· Two measurements can be substituted after scheduling it with the laboratory instructor.
· If there is still a scheduled measuring group during the rest of the semester which has not taken the specified measurement, and the number of participated students allows to join, the measurement can be substituted only in that occasion.
· If – after discussing with the lab instructor – it is not an option, the measurement can be substituted at the end of the semester, during the supplementary week.
· In case of the missed measurements are substituted later, then the exam measurement is scheduled, the affected measurement cannot be allocated to the student on the exam measurement.
It is not possible to have any extra measurement for correcting lower sub-marks.
